The Dutch League 2020 Season awards Championship Points towards qualification for the Country Finals.

Format[]

  • The winner of the Dutch League 2020 Summer Playoffs automatically qualifies (AQ) for the Country Finals as 1st seed.
  • The three other seeds are determined by accumulating points.
  • Championship Points determine the Country Finals' seeding.

Championship Points Tiebreaker[]

  • If multiple Teams are tied in Championship Points at the conclusion of the Summer Split, then the Team which gained the most Championship Points in the Summer Split will be considered the higher seed.
  • If two Teams gained the same amount of Championship Points in the Summer Split, then their Summer Split Regular Season standings will be the first tiebreaker.
  • If two Teams had the same Summer Split Regular Season standings, then their Summer Split Regular Season head-to-head record will be the second tiebreaker.
  • If two Teams had the same head-to-head record, then their wins in the second half of the Summer Split will used to break the tie.
  • If two Teams have the same amount of wins in the second half of the Summer Split, they will play a tiebreaker-game.
